What if your workouts had stakes?
FitRivals turns daily activity into head-to-head competition. Players challenge each other in 1v1, 2v2, 3v3, or free-for-all formats, with real Apple Health data as the source of truth.
Under the hood:
- HealthKit background delivery — activity syncs silently even when the app is closed
- Pre-aggregated Firestore architecture — player stats computed and stored at write time, not read time. Fast queries at scale.
- Widget suite — Heatmap, Battle Status, and Today's Score widgets via WidgetKit
- Universal Links — deep linking via inkwellcode.com so challenge invites land exactly where they should
- Push notification system — rebuilt from scratch for reliability and meaningful alerts, not noise
- Cinematic onboarding — because first impressions are load-bearing
Currently in alpha. Built solo.
